How to Find the Right Pre-Sale Building Inspection Services in Southshore

Many sellers wait until the buyer’s inspector finds issues, which leads to price cuts, repair rush, and sometimes a cancelled deal. The fix is simple: book a pre-sale house inspection two to four weeks before you list, do a quick check like running each sink for one minute to spot slow drains, and let’s check roof, structure, plumbing, electrical, heating and cooling, exterior, attic, and crawlspace with photos and a same day report.

  • Book early with a licensed inspector
  • Fix simple defects before photos
  • Clear access to attic & crawlspace
  • Collect permits, warranties, & receipts

You will cut surprise repair credits, speed up disclosures, and reduce back and forth after buyer house inspections and building inspections. Many homes sell faster and with fewer concessions when sellers share a clean pre-sale report and receipts for minor fixes.

How should I get my home ready for a pre-sale inspection?

Make all parts of the home easy to reach–attic, garage, and the areas under sinks. Clean the place and handle simple maintenance ahead of time. For a smooth house inspections and building inspections experience, call Christchurch Building Inspections in Southshore at 0800 846 525.
